Essay
Grading Guidelines |
Grade |
Description: "The paper . . . " |
A |
demonstrates a novel and creative approach. |
|
|
B |
fully meets the specified assignment. |
|
employs adequate and reliable sources. |
|
employs appropriate examples. |
|
approaches sources critically. |
|
correctly and completely cites sources (e.g., Chicago Manual of Style). |
|
exhibits correct spelling, punctuation, grammar, and vocabulary. |
|
presents a balanced approach to the subject. |
|
is clear, logical, and persuasive. |
|
arrives in on time. |
|
|
C |
has many of the above characteristics, but fails to realize them fully. |
|
(Such essays suggest that the writer needs to work through at least one more draft.) |
|
|
D |
has significant problems and/or numerous small problems. |
|
(Such essays suggest that the writer has worked quickly through a single draft.) |
|
|
F |
has substantial problems. |
